#6849ba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#6849ba is composed of 40.8% red, 28.6% green and 72.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 44.1% cyan, 60.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 27.1% black. It has a hue angle of 256.5 degrees, a saturation of 45% and a lightness of 50.8%. #6849ba color hex could be obtained by blending #d092ff with #000075. Closest websafe color is: #6633cc.

#6849ba color description : Moderate violet.

#6849ba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#6849ba has RGB values of R:104, G:73, B:186 and CMYK values of C:0.44, M:0.61, Y:0, K:0.27. Its decimal value is 6834618.

Shades and Tints of #6849ba

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020103 is the darkest color, while #f6f4fb is the lightest one.

Tones of #6849ba

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7e798a is the less saturated color, while #4a05fe is the most saturated one.
